Hiring Trend Watchpoints

High-performing operators in the Equatorial Margin & Frontiers theme are expected to show robust hiring in specialized offshore roles, particularly in deepwater drilling, subsea engineering, fabrication, and maintenance, especially within Guyana, Suriname, and Brazil. There is a rising demand for digital and automation roles, including control systems engineers, data scientists for AI-driven optimization, and remote diagnostics technicians, as companies leverage technology to enhance efficiency and safety. Workforce evidence suggests a focus on agile staffing models, with direct hire for long-duration capital projects and strategic use of contingent workforces to address project surges. Companies are also investing in knowledge transfer programs to counter the impact of an aging workforce, with nearly half of the traditional energy workforce aged 45 or older. Changes confirming theme execution would include a sustained increase in job postings for deepwater exploration and development, particularly for project execution and operational phases in the core regions, alongside a growing mix of digital and environmental compliance roles. Conversely, a significant decline in exploration and development job postings, a lack of investment in local workforce training, or a failure to attract younger talent into specialized roles would signal theme deterioration.

Second Order Trends

Several second-order trends are shaping the Regional Oil '26: Equatorial Margin & Frontiers theme. Firstly, **Natural Gas Monetization** is gaining prominence, particularly in Guyana's Stabroek Block, where ExxonMobil is focusing on significant recoverable gas resources and projects like the Gas-to-Energy initiative are nearing completion. The proposed Longtail development specifically targets non-associated gas, indicating a strategic shift beyond crude oil. Secondly, there's an increasing emphasis on **Energy Transition Integration** within traditional oil and gas operations. Companies like Petrobras are actively advancing in renewable content fuels (Sustainable Aviation Fuel, green diesel) and adopting lower-emissions technologies in new FPSOs in Guyana, reflecting a 'just transition' approach. Thirdly, **Digitalization and Automation** are becoming critical for operational excellence, with AI-driven optimization, remote-controlled FPSOs, and advanced control systems being deployed to enhance efficiency and safety in complex deepwater environments. Fourthly, **Local Content Development** is a significant narrative, especially in Guyana, where the government is enforcing local content acts to ensure national participation in employment, procurement, and capacity building, influencing how international operators structure their in-country operations. Finally, persistent **Geopolitical Volatility** in other major oil-producing regions (e.g., Middle East, Red Sea, Black Sea) is contributing to oil price fluctuations and supply chain disruptions, inadvertently reinforcing the strategic importance and investment appeal of stable, high-growth frontier basins like the Equatorial Margin.

Top datasets to track

1. Guyana Crude Oil Production Data Type: company_level · Provider: Government of Guyana, Ministry of Natural Resources Cadence: Monthly Why it matters: Directly measures the operational success and output from the Stabroek Block, a core asset for ExxonMobil, Chevron, and CNOOC, indicating theme strengthening or weakening. Suggested query: Guyana oil production statistics Confidence: high

2. Brazil Equatorial Margin Exploration Well Results (Morpho) Type: company_level · Provider: Petrobras, IBAMA, ANP Cadence: Event-driven (expected August 2026) Why it matters: A critical catalyst for Petrobras' frontier growth strategy; a successful discovery would significantly de-risk future exploration and boost the theme. Suggested query: Petrobras Morpho well results Foz do Amazonas Confidence: high

3. Brent Crude Oil Futures Prices Type: economic_data · Provider: ICE Futures Europe, EIA, J.P. Morgan, Goldman Sachs, Citi Cadence: Daily Why it matters: The primary global benchmark for crude oil, directly impacting the revenues and profitability of all theme constituents. Volatility reflects geopolitical risks and demand/supply dynamics. Suggested query: Brent crude oil price Confidence: high

4. Suriname Block 58 GranMorgu Project Milestones Type: company_level · Provider: APA Corporation, TotalEnergies, Staatsolie Cadence: Quarterly/Event-driven Why it matters: Tracks the progress of APA Corporation's key frontier asset towards first oil in 2028, indicating execution strength and future production potential. Suggested query: APA Corporation GranMorgu project update Confidence: high

5. Global Offshore Rig Count (Latin America Focus) Type: alt_data · Provider: Baker Hughes, Rystad Energy, Wood Mackenzie Cadence: Monthly Why it matters: An indicator of exploration and development activity and investment appetite in deepwater basins across the region, signaling overall theme health. Suggested query: Latin America offshore rig count Confidence: high
